About this role 

The Senior Data Scientist will play a pivotal role in our Data Science team, reporting directly to the Head of Data Science and collaborating closely with other data scientists, medical coding specialists, solutions managers, and digital marketing specialists. In this role, you will be responsible for researching, developing, and deploying machine learning algorithms aimed at identifying and prioritizing needs for various medical services. Additionally, you will optimize outreach efforts to enhance member engagement, promote utilization of medically appropriate services, and reduce churn and acquisition costs.

What we’re looking for 

  • Education: 
    • Bachelor's or master's degree in computer science, Statistics, Mathematics, Data Science, or a related field. 
  • Experience: 
    • 5+ years of hands-on experience in developing and deploying machine learning models in a production environment. 
  • Skills and Abilities: 
    • Strong focus on data-driven decision-making and problem-solving skills. 
    • Ability to collaborate with stakeholders to translate business needs into data science questions. 
    • Expertise in Python and machine learning libraries, including sklearn and TensorFlow. 
    • Successful deployment of supervised, unsupervised, and reinforcement learning models to production. 
    • Expert in SQL, Experience with no-SQL and semi-structured data 
    • Familiarity with natural language processing techniques including modern transformer based LLMs. 
    • Experience with data science platforms such as Snowflake, Databricks, Sagemaker, MLFlow, AWS EC2, S3, and Spark. 
  • Statistical Techniques:
    • Expert in statistical techniques, including hypothesis testing, experiment design, and online learning.
